Output ec23ba73b9c9dff5a9ff57b61e0bba530b02808f32aff78cec4088f0e3e6d530:1

value
138600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2699b1272a37da66fab00b7b14163c8be502de23 OP_EQUAL
address
35D7iYL19N6gxHtBaJ7qWKWAJJuM5KfaWk
transaction
ec23ba73b9c9dff5a9ff57b61e0bba530b02808f32aff78cec4088f0e3e6d530
confirmations
194840
spent
true